Sourcing Organic Raw Cotton: A Comprehensive Guide

Finding dependable organic raw cotton can be a difficult undertaking for brands committed to sustainability. This guide details the key factors involved, beginning with understanding certification bodies such as GOTS and OCS - verifying that the commodity is truly grown without harmful pesticides or synthetic chemicals . Evaluation must also be given to geographic origins; Turkey are major producers, but transparency throughout the supply chain – from farm to ginning mill and beyond – is paramount. Building direct relationships with farmers or working through reputable brokers who prioritize ethical practices can ensure traceability and a consistent flow. Finally, assess condition attributes like micronaire, strength, and color to meet your desired manufacturing specifications – opting for certified organic doesn't automatically guarantee the perfect material characteristics.

Identifying Trustworthy Organic Cotton Suppliers for Your Business

Securing a steady supply of high-quality certified organic cotton is crucial for any business committed to sustainability. Finding the right providers requires diligent research and verification. Begin by exploring online databases specializing in ethical sourcing, like those dedicated to fair trade or GOTS (Global Organic Textile Standard) standards. Thoroughly assess potential collaborations by requesting detailed documentation about their farming practices – look for verifiable evidence of organic farming methods, including soil health, water usage and pesticide avoidance. Evaluate conducting site visits if feasible, or asking for third-party audits to confirm the vendor’s claims. A robust quality control process, with regular fabric testing, is also essential to maintain your enterprise's integrity and meet customer expectations.

The Rise of Organic Cotton: Benefits and Sourcing Options

Increasingly widespread, organic cotton is gaining traction as a responsible alternative to conventional cotton Organic Cotton Shipment Worldwide production. Its advantages extend beyond just environmental concerns; organically grown cotton usually results in softer, more breathable fabrics that are gentler on the skin. The process eschews toxic pesticides and synthetic fertilizers, which protects farmer well-being, safeguards ecosystems, and reduces water degradation. Consumers now have a growing range of sourcing options to choose from – including direct partnerships with producers, certifications like GOTS (Global Organic Textile Standard), and platforms that confirm the organic integrity of cotton products. Seeking out brands transparent about their supply chains is essential to ensuring truly ethical and environmentally sound selections.
